Output 1258bf7988beb6df79bd6fb29ee7896627c88a7e490e5e16d08e971a952feb6f:6

value
4486025
script pubkey
OP_0 OP_PUSHBYTES_20 301318953dec0f459e88258765f4649c204d8d96
address
bc1qxqf339faas85t85gykrktarynssymrvkvfkpa6
transaction
1258bf7988beb6df79bd6fb29ee7896627c88a7e490e5e16d08e971a952feb6f
confirmations
117909
spent
true